How much is a short haired German Shepherd?
A Short Haired German Shepherd will cost between $500 and $1,500. The better the dog’s pedigree, the more expensive the puppy will be. Unfortunately, many German Shepherds do end up in shelters. Adoption prices range from free to $250.
Can you get a short haired German Shepherd?
A short-haired German shepherd is just another term for a standard German shepherd dog (GSD). This is the coat length you’re most likely to picture when you think of a GSD. They’re sometimes referred to as “short-haired” by some pup parents because their coat is short compared to long-coat varieties of the breed.
Are short-haired German Shepherds purebred?
Both dogs are the same breed, and while a short-hair German Shepherd is the only type of German Shepherd accepted in kennel clubs in the United States and much of the world, both short-haired and long-haired dogs can be purebred German Shepherds.
Do long haired German Shepherds shed more than short-haired German Shepherds?
Long-haired German Shepherds do not shed more than short-haired types, although the rate of shedding varies throughout the year among short-haired GSDs. That is because their undercoat is the source of a significant amount of shedding, and it sheds more during the spring and fall seasons.
Are two German Shepherds better than one?
Getting two German Shepherds of the opposite sex seems to be a better choice considering dogs are less likely to fight with the opposite sex. Ideally, the two dogs should have at least 1.5 to 2 years apart to avoid excessive bonding between each other that may impede their socialization with humans and other dogs.

Do German Shepherds better than Belgian Shepherds?
Belgian Shepherds and German Shepherds may be different breeds but they have a lot of similarities, not least in their appearance. They are both reasonably healthy dogs, are intelligent and need to be kept active. However, German Shepherds are easier to train and make better family pets.
